DURHAM Women are looking to continue their positive momentum against Yorkshire in the Metro Bank One Day Cup today.

Dani Hazell has named a squad of 14 for the game at Banks Homes Riverside (10.30am), with Leah Dobson added to the group from last weekend’s trip to Chelmsford, where Durham defeated Essex by 46 runs.

Hazell’s side sit fifth in the One Day Cup, having picked up four victories and a tie for their 19 points from nine games so far.

Richard Pyrah’s Yorkshire sit seventh on 12 points, having claimed two wins and a tie from eight games.

Durham played out an enthralling final-ball tie in their previous One Day Cup clash with the White Rose at Scarborough as both teams put on 290, with Phoebe Turner and Jess Jonassen both scoring centuries.
